Remembering David Hockney ❤️
We are deeply saddened by the news of David Hockney's passing.
One of the most influential artists of the modern era and a leader in the 1960s pop art movement, David Hockney was born in Bradford and went on to become one of the world's most celebrated and recognisable artists.
We have been incredibly proud to showcase David Hockney's work here at the National Science and Media Museum. The above image is of Hockney creating one of his celebrated photographic joiners featuring the museum, a work that was most recently displayed in our exhibition David Hockney: Pieced Together in January 2025.
A pioneering artist who continually embraced new ways of seeing and making images, Hockney leaves behind an extraordinary legacy that continues to inspire audiences in Bradford and around the world.
📸 David Hockney creating a joiner of the National Science and Media Museum , Bradford 19 or 20 July 1985.
